输入源码输出反码? 输入源码输出反码的方法?

关于计算机存储的是补码问题

计算系统中,数值,一律采用补码表示和存储。在计算机中,原码反码,都是不存在的。因此,原码反码,根本就没有任何用处,不必讨论。数值与八位补码的关系如下:short s = 129; // 这是-127 的补码。为什么最后输出的是-127?printf(%d, s); // 按照“带符号数”输出,就是-127。

计算机中的负数用补码存储主要是为了方便运算。具体原因如下:简化加法运算:补码的设计使得计算机在进行减法运算时,可以将其转化为加法运算。例如,计算AB,可以转化为A+,其中B就是B的补码。这样,计算机就只需要一种运算电路就可以完成加减运算,从而简化了硬件设计。

计算机使用补码存储数据,这一设计主要是为了简化加法运算。补码,顾名思义,是一种编码方式,使得加法在计算机系统内得以高效执行。以十进制数100为例,转换为16进制为64H。若以8位二进制表示,则为01100100B。正数的补码与其原码相同,因此100的补码仍然是01100100。

计算机中的负数用补码存储是为了方便加法运算。以下是具体原因:补码简化了加减法运算:在计算机中,补码使得加法运算可以同时处理正数和负数,而无需额外的逻辑来判断数的符号。例如,计算100109可以转换为100+,只需将109转换为补码后进行加法运算即可。

计算机中的负数用补码存储是为了方便加法运算。具体原因如下:简化运算:补码的设计使得计算机在进行加减法运算时,只需通过加法器即可完成,无需设计复杂的减法器。这是因为任何两个数的减法都可以转化为加上第二个数的补码来进行计算。

+0或者-0的源码、反码、补码

1、原码是00000000-0原码是100000000反码是00000000-0反码是111111110补码是00000000补码没有正0与负0之分正数的反码、补码和其原码相同负数的反码是其原码除符号位外其他位取反负数的补码是取其反码后加1。

2、[+0]原码=0000 0000, [-0]原码=1000 0000 [+0]反码=0000 0000, [-0]反码=1111 1111 [+0]补码=0000 0000, [-0]补码=0000 0000 补码没有正0与负0之分。正数的反码、补码和其源码相同,负数的反码是其源码,除符号位外其他位取反负数的补码是取其反码后加1。

输入源码输出反码? 输入源码输出反码的方法?

3、[+0]原码=0000 0000, [-0]原码=1000 0000;[+0]反码=0000 0000, [-0]反码=1111 1111;[+0]补码=0000 0000, [-0]补码=0000 0000。在这里你会发现,+0和-0的补码是一样的,即0的补码只有一种表示。在计算机内,符号数有3种表示法:原码、反码和补码。

4、设机器字长为8,对于数值0,其原码表示为[+0]原=00000000,[-0]原=10000000;其反码表示为[+0]反=00000000,[-0]反=11111111;其补码表示为[+0]补=00000000,[-0]补=00000000;若偏移量为27,则0的移码表示为[+0]移=10000000,[-0]移=10000000。

5、源码:即数字原本的二进制形式。对于非负数,源码就是其本身的二进制表示。0的源码就是0000。 反码:在表示负数时,反码是对源码取反,但对于正数或零,其反码与其源码相同。因此,0的反码仍然是0。 补码:补码是计算机中最常用的编码方式,用于表示正数和负数。

6、补码的理论,来源于数学的规律,并非是人为的胡编乱造。0 的八位补码,只有一个,就是:0000 0000。零,在补码中,只用唯一的一组代码来表示,这就不会产生混乱。--- 求补码,书上介绍的方法,就是:取反加一。但是,原码反码中,都是没有 0 和-128。

小数的原码是多少

1、具体而言,原码的符号位由小数的正负决定,正数的符号位为0,负数的符号位为1。以x=-0.11101为例,其原码形式为x=11101。接下来,转换成反码,即将原码除了符号位外的每一位取反,即0变1,1变0。对于上述例子,反码形式为x=00010。最后一步是转换成补码,即将反码加1。

2、和10000本就是原码。8位字长纯小数,第一位为符号位,小数点在第一位后面,后七位为具体数值,如: -0.1001原码表示为1001,反码为0110,补码为0111;-1的补码为0000000。

3、原码:(小数):0.1111111——1111111 (整数):01111111——11111111 补码: (小数):0.1111111——0000000 (整数):0111111——10000000 反码: (小数):无 (整数):无 详情请从百度搜索“原码、补码、反码”。 然后点击第一个。

4、小数部分的原码和补码可以表示为两个复数的分子和分母,然后计算二进制小数系统,根据下面三步的方法就会找出小数源代码和补码的百位形式。

5、原码的定义具体分为小数和整数两种形式。对于小数原码,定义如下:[X] = X (0≤X 1 )1- X (-1 X ≤ 0)例如,若X等于+0.1011,则原码[X]原为0.1011;若X等于-0.1011,则原码[X]原为1011。

关键词: